Blair

(BLAIR)

Blair is an English-language name of Scottish Gaelic origin. The surname is derived from any of the numerous places in Scotland named Blair. These place names are derived from the Scottish Gaelic blàr, meaning "plain" and "field". The given name Blair is derived from the surname.

Meaning: From the field of battle Origin: Gaelic
